Frames moeten een titel hebben

Laatste wijziging:

Deze controle is onderdeel van de Accessibility test van ExcellentWebCheck. Het waarborgen van de toegankelijkheid van een website is essentieel om ervoor te zorgen dat iedereen het internet zonder belemmeringen kan gebruiken.

Hoe het probleem op te lossen?

Een <frame> of <iframe> zonder een titel kan niet correct worden aangekondigd door schermlezers. Zonder een titel is het moeilijk voor gebruikers van schermlezers om te schakelen tussen frames op een pagina.

Gebruik een van de volgende opties om het probleem op te lossen:

Option 1: Gebruik een title attribute

Voeg het title attribuut toe:

<iframe src="/news-item.html" title="New accessibility tool launched"></iframe>

Option 2: gebruik aria-label

<iframe src="/news-item.html"
  aria-label="New accessibility tool launched"
></iframe>

Option 3: gebruik aria-labelledby

<div id="iframe-label">New accessibility tool launched:</div>

<iframe src="/news-item.html" aria-labelledby="iframe-label"></iframe>

Wat is een goede titel?

Zorg ervoor dat u een beschrijvende titel aan het frame toevoegt. Een effectieve manier om een titel te bedenken, is door je voor te stellen dat je de inhoud van het frame hardop aan iemand beschrijft.

 

Zorg ervoor dat elke frame-titel uniek is op de pagina. Schermlezers stellen gebruikers in staat om tussen frames te schakelen. Het is niet mogelijk om frames te onderscheiden als ze dezelfde naam hebben.

Heeft dit artikel u geholpen?

De diensten van ExcellentWebCheck

Het doel van ExcellentWebCheck is om de online gebruikerservaring van alle bezoekers van websites te verbeteren. De tools van ExcellentWebCheck helpen bij het detecteren en verbeteren van usability-problemen op uw website.